Why Your Car Sounds Different in Cold Weather — And What Each Noise Means

If your car suddenly sounds worse in winter — squealing when you start it, clunking over bumps, rattling from the dashboard — you’re not imagining it. Cold weather changes the physical properties of nearly every material in your car at once. Rubber stiffens, metal contracts, fluids thicken, and moisture freezes in places it shouldn’t. Most of these sounds are harmless and go away once the car warms up. A few are warning signs. Knowing the difference saves you from either unnecessary panic or an avoidable breakdown.

Why Cold Weather Changes How Your Car Sounds

The short version: cold shrinks things. Metal, rubber, and plastic all contract at different rates, which creates small gaps and misalignments that don’t exist in warm weather. Rubber loses flexibility and grips less effectively. Lubricants thicken and flow more slowly. Moisture freezes on surfaces it normally evaporates from. All of this creates noise — and most of it is temporary.

The useful rule: if the noise is gone after the car warms up, it’s the cold. If it’s still there after 10–15 minutes of normal driving, investigate it.

How to Tell If the Noise Is Normal or a Sign of a Problem

High-pitched squeal on startup

A sharp squeal from the engine bay when you first start the car is almost always the serpentine belt. Cold rubber stiffens and grips the pulleys less effectively, causing the belt to slip briefly. This is extremely common and usually not a problem if it stops within a minute or two as the engine warms.

When it becomes a concern: if the squeal is accompanied by heavy steering, a flickering battery warning light, or fluctuating engine temperature, the belt may be slipping enough to affect critical systems. A squeal that persists after the car is warm, or gets louder when you turn the wheel, points to a worn belt, failing tensioner, or worn pulley bearings — all worth having inspected.

Groaning or whining when turning the wheel

Power steering fluid thickens in cold weather, making the pump work harder to push it through the system. A brief groan when turning the wheel on a cold morning is normal. It should go away within a few minutes.

If the groaning is loud, persists after the car warms up, or the steering feels heavy and unresponsive, check the power steering fluid level. Low or old fluid makes the problem worse in cold weather and can accelerate pump wear.

Clunking or creaking over bumps

The warning sign is a clunk that continues after the car is fully warmed up, or one that gets louder during turns specifically. Clunking that grows louder with speed or during turns can indicate worn driveline components like CV joints or deteriorating suspension parts — those don’t go away with warmth.

Squeaking brakes first thing in the morning

If the squeak continues beyond that, or you hear grinding (metal on metal), that’s worn brake pads — not a cold weather issue, and something that needs attention regardless of season.

Dashboard and interior rattles

Metal and plastic contract in cold temperatures at slightly different rates. This creates small gaps between panels that vibrate against each other until the cabin heats up and everything expands back to normal. Annoying but harmless.

If a rattle is coming from under the car rather than inside it, check for a loose heat shield — the metal covers over the exhaust system. Cold causes exhaust gaps and loose heat shields to vibrate loudly when the engine is cold. A loose heat shield rattles loudly, especially at idle, and can usually be spotted visually underneath the car — it’s a cheap fix at any shop.

Ticking or tapping from the engine

Oil thickens in cold weather and takes a few seconds longer to circulate fully when you first start the car. A brief ticking sound on a cold start — especially from the top of the engine — is normal as the valvetrain waits for oil pressure to build. It should stop within 10–30 seconds.

If the ticking continues after the car has been running for several minutes, it may indicate low oil level, wrong oil viscosity for the climate, or worn valve components. Check the oil level first.

How to Reduce Cold Weather Noises and Protect Your Car in Winter

  • Let the car idle for 30–60 seconds before driving. You don’t need a long warm-up, but giving oil a few seconds to circulate reduces the wear on cold components and lets most cold-start noises settle before you put load on the engine.
  • Don’t ignore noises that come with physical symptoms. Heavy steering, pulling to one side, vibration through the pedals, or warning lights alongside a noise upgrade it from “probably fine” to “needs attention.” Sound alone is one thing; sound plus a change in how the car behaves is another.
  • Check tire pressure when noises appear. Cold weather drops tire pressure roughly 1 PSI per 10°F. Underinflated tires create road noise and change handling in ways that can seem like suspension noise. Quick and easy to rule out.
  • Inspect belt and fluid conditions before winter. Most cold-weather belt squeals come from a belt that was already worn or glazed — cold just reveals it. Checking belt condition and power steering fluid level in fall means fewer unpleasant surprises in January.
  • A heat shield rattle is not an exhaust leak. It sounds alarming and is easy to confuse, but a rattling heat shield is harmless on its own. An exhaust leak sounds more like a ticking or hissing and may come with a smell. Still worth fixing either way.

What to Do Based on the Type of Noise You’re Hearing

Belt squeals for more than a few minutes after startup. Inspect the belt for cracking, glazing, or missing ribs. Check the tensioner — a weak tensioner spring won’t maintain proper belt tension in cold conditions. If either looks worn, replace before the belt fails completely. Serpentine belt failure means loss of the alternator, power steering pump, and water pump simultaneously.

Clunking continues after 15 minutes of driving. This is no longer a cold-weather noise — it’s a mechanical symptom. Where you hear it narrows it down: over bumps straight ahead points to struts or bushings; clunking specifically during turns points to CV joints or sway bar end links. Have a mechanic inspect the front suspension.

Brakes squeak all winter, not just at startup. If brake noise persists beyond the first stop or two, it’s not rotor rust — it’s likely worn brake pads or pads that have glazed from infrequent use. Cold weather can accelerate this. Get the pads measured.

Heat shield rattle drives you crazy. A mechanic can tighten or clamp a loose heat shield for very little money. It’s purely a noise issue and won’t cause further damage, but if it’s driving you crazy it’s a fast fix.

Engine ticks for several minutes on cold starts. Check oil level first. If it’s fine, check that you’re running the oil viscosity your owner’s manual recommends for your climate. A 10W oil in sub-zero temperatures is slower to circulate than a 5W oil, which extends the startup tick. If ticking continues past warm-up regardless, have valve clearance and oil pressure checked.

Frequently Asked Questions

Why does my car make more noise in cold weather? Cold shrinks rubber, metal, and plastic at different rates, creating gaps and stiffness that produce noise. Most of it is temporary and goes away as the car warms to operating temperature.

Is it normal for my car to squeal when I start it in winter? A brief squeal from the engine bay on a cold start is normal — it’s the serpentine belt stiffening in cold temperatures. If it stops within a minute or two, it’s fine. If it persists or comes with heavy steering, have the belt and tensioner inspected.

Why do my brakes squeak in the morning in winter? Overnight cold causes light surface rust to form on brake rotors. The first few stops scrape it off and make a brief squeaking or grinding sound. This is normal and harmless as long as it stops after the first few brake applications.

What does a clunking noise over bumps mean in cold weather? Usually stiff suspension bushings — they harden in cold temperatures and transmit more vibration. If the clunk disappears after the car warms up, it’s temperature-related. If it persists after driving for 15+ minutes, it could indicate worn bushings, ball joints, or CV joints that need inspection.

What’s that rattling sound from under my car in winter? Likely a loose heat shield over the exhaust. Cold metal contracts and can loosen fasteners that held tight in warmer weather. It sounds alarming but is usually harmless. Easy and cheap to fix at a shop.

When should I actually be concerned about a winter noise? When it persists after the car reaches operating temperature, when it comes with a change in how the car drives, or when it involves grinding metal. Noises that go away after a few minutes are almost always cold-related and normal.
